Searching for birth family

Originally Posted By Marlou Russell, Adoptee Forum

Dear Adoptee:
I'm not sure what you have tried in your process of search so I would suggest you go to Colleen's Search site here on the Experts Board and give her a little background so she can help you with the next step.

There are a number of aspects of search. One is the footwork of search - calling, writing, researching records, etc. that you can do with Colleen's help. Another aspect of search is being emotionally ready for a reunion.

It is important to ask yourself what you are trying to find and being prepared for any outcome. This is a great time to pull together your support system of other adoptees and to read all you can on search and reunion in adoption (check the book selections at this site). You can also go to Carole Bird's Birth parent forum on the Experts Board to get a sense of what birth parents are all about.

Take your time in preparing yourself for a reunion. This is a very important time for you.

I wish you the best in your search.
